Congressional Summary of HR 1252
Uncovering UNRWA’s Terrorist Crimes Act
This bill prohibits federal funds from being used to provide funding, directly or indirectly, to the United Nations Relief and Works Agency for Palestine Refugees in the Near East (UNRWA).
The bill also requires the Department of State to report to Congress on (1) the total U.S. funding to UNRWA from FY2020 through FY2024, and (2) how such funds were spent.
Current Status of Bill HR 1252
Bill HR 1252 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since February 12, 2025. Bill HR 1252 was introduced during Congress 119 and was introduced to the House on February 12, 2025. Bill HR 1252's most recent activity was Referred to the House Committee on Foreign Affairs. as of February 12, 2025
